- Pull upstream patch 2613 so as not to conflict with mod_deflate [1]

(http://article.gmane.org/gmane.comp.web.fastcgi)
- Enable module by default [2]

PR:		ports/156251 [2] ports/163199 [1]
Submitted by:	Denny Lin <dennylin93@hs.ntnu.edu.tw> [1]
		Gea-Suan Lin <gslin@gslin.org> [2]
With Hat:	apache@
This commit is contained in:
Philip M. Gollucci 2012-01-18 04:31:26 +00:00
parent 91fae18456
commit 5afc4c6757
Notes: svn2git 2021-03-31 03:12:20 +00:00
svn path=/head/; revision=289396
2 changed files with 18 additions and 1 deletions

View File

@ -7,7 +7,7 @@
PORTNAME= mod_fastcgi
PORTVERSION= 2.4.6
PORTREVISION= 2
PORTREVISION= 3
CATEGORIES= www
MASTER_SITES= http://www.fastcgi.com/dist/
@ -23,6 +23,9 @@ AP_GENPLIST= yes
SRC_FILE= *.c
PORTDOCS= LICENSE.TERMS mod_fastcgi.html
do-install:
@${APXS} -i -a -n ${SHORTMODNAME} ${WRKSRC}/${MODULENAME}.${AP_BUILDEXT}
post-install:
.if !defined(NOPORTDOCS)
${MKDIR} ${DOCSDIR}

View File

@ -0,0 +1,14 @@
--- mod_fastcgi.c.orig 2011-12-12 15:37:24.211384000 +0800
+++ mod_fastcgi.c 2011-12-12 15:37:50.565004000 +0800
@@ -754,6 +754,11 @@
continue;
}
+ if (strcasecmp(name, "Content-Length") == 0) {
+ ap_set_content_length(r, strtol(value, NULL, 10));
+ continue;
+ }
+
/* If the script wants them merged, it can do it */
ap_table_add(r->err_headers_out, name, value);
continue;